PHT 2321C - Disabilities and PT Proced III |
(5) (A.S.)Six hours class and eight hours laboratory per week for ten weeks. Prerequisite: Completion of PHT 1007C, PHT 1124C, PHT 1211C, PHT 1800L, and PHT 2337C with a grade of "C" or better. Corequisite: PHT 2810L. This course introduces student to the study of neuromotor development and the treatment and rehabilitation of pediatric and adult neurologic diseases, disorders and disabilities through physical therapy intervention. Additional special fees are required.
